Woman, son killed in Ill. tollway crash
Illinois State Police say Nicole Polk, of Algoma, Wis., and her 16-month-old son, Tevin Temple, were declared dead on the Tri-State Tollway in Lake County, Ill., in what may be an alcohol-related crash, the Chicago Tribune reported.
Also critically injured in the crash was Polk's 2 1/2-year-old son, whom police said. State Police Master Sgt. Susan Ewald told the Tribune Polk was not wearing her seatbelt and open alcohol was found in her car after the crash.
Police said Polk's car crossed a grassy median between the northbound and southbound lanes of the tollway, which also is Interstate 94, and crashed head-on with an oncoming vehicle whose driver and three passengers sustained only minor injuries, the newspaper said.
